458 days. On average, that’s how long it takes for unions and employers to agree on a first contract.

is fighting to change that. The Faster Labor Contracts Act means workers can negotiate for higher wages, better benefits and safer workplaces without endless delay.

The FAFSA Simplification Act was an important first step to expand access to Pell Grants for students and families.

Congress should continue this work and do more to make college more affordable.

The FAFSA Simplification Act, passed by Congress in 2020, has met its goals, with more students eligible for the Pell Grant than ever before and a larger proportion of those students receiving the maximum award, a new report from the Government Accountability Office shows.
